For example, a typical home build costs $115,000 to $450,000, making the total architect fee $9,200 to $67,500, with an average of $32,500.įees can go as high as 15% to 20% for remodeling projects and as low as 5% for new construction jobs, depending on the project's complexity. Project management or administration: $2–$5 per square foot, depending on the level of onsite construction oversight and document administration.Īrchitects charge 8% to 15% of the total construction cost for most projects. Each phase of work can be separated into a cost per square foot as follows:Ĭoncept development and drafts: $2–$5 per square foot, including preliminary design consultation, site visit, and initial draft documents.Ĭonstruction documents: $2–$5 per square foot with detailed drawings for all construction elements, from framing to electrical and plumbing. Hourly rates make sense for smaller projects or to solve a specific design issue. Intern architects typically run $65 to $90 per hour, but they need to work alongside a higher level architect, so you'll likely see a bill for both. ![]() If you hire an architect on an hourly basis, expect $125 to $250 per hour for a principal or project manager level architect. Joker premiered at the 76th Venice International Film Festival on August 31, 2019, where it won the Golden Lion, and was theatrically released in the United States on October 4. Joker is the first live-action theatrical Batman film to receive an R rating from the Motion Picture Association. Principal photography took place in New York City, Jersey City and Newark, from September to December 2018. Phoenix became attached in February 2018 and was cast that July, while the majority of the cast signed on by August. The film loosely adapts plot elements from Batman: The Killing Joke (1988), but Phillips and Silver otherwise did not look to specific comics for inspiration. The two were inspired by 1970s character studies and the films of Martin Scorsese, particularly Taxi Driver (1976) and The King of Comedy (1982), who was initially attached to the project as a producer. Phillips conceived Joker in 2016 and wrote the script with Silver throughout 2017. Pictures and DC Films in association with Village Roadshow Pictures, Bron Creative and Joint Effort. Pictures, Joker was produced by Warner Bros. Robert De Niro, Zazie Beetz and Frances Conroy appear in supporting roles. Set in 1981, it follows Arthur Fleck, a failed clown and aspiring stand-up comic whose descent into mental illness and nihilism inspires a violent countercultural revolution against the wealthy in a decaying Gotham City. The film, based on DC Comics characters, stars Joaquin Phoenix as Joker.
